A method and apparatus for acquiring timing signals for use in a
positioning receiver using timing assistance provided by a wireless
communications system, such as cellular telephone system. A mobile
terminal equipped with a positioning receiver operates in a wireless
communications system having control channels and at least one traffic
channel unsynchronized to the control channels. The mobile terminal camps
on a first control channel in a first cell having a first time base
associated therewith. While camped on the control channel, the mobile
terminal establishes a local clock reference, internal to the mobile
terminal, capable of tracking the first time base. The mobile terminal
then operates on a first traffic channel that is unsynchronized to the
first control channel and notes the difference in time bases between the
control channel and the traffic channel. Either while camped on the
control channel or while operating on the traffic channel, the mobile
terminal receives TDMA-to-GPS relationship data, which is a measure of the
offset between system time for the wireless communications system as
expressed on particular control channel ("TDMA time") and the system time
for the GPS system ("GPS time"). Thereafter, an accurate estimate of the
GPS time is calculated in the mobile terminal based on the local clock
reference and the TDMA-to-GPS relationship data. In some aspects, the
local clock reference is updated based on the first traffic channel so as
to minimize errors arising from timing drift.
Une méthode et un appareil pour acquérir des signaux de synchronisation pour l'usage dans un récepteur de positionnement employant l'aide de synchronisation ont fourni par un système de communications sans fil, tel que le système de téléphone cellulaire. Une borne mobile équipée d'un récepteur de positionnement fonctionne dans un système de communications sans fil ayant des canaux de commande et au moins un canal du trafic unsynchronized aux canaux de commande. Les camps terminaux de mobile sur un premier canal de commande dans une première cellule ayant une base de première fois se sont associés en conséquence. Tandis que campée sur le canal de commande, la borne mobile établit une référence d'horloge locale, interne à la borne mobile, capable de dépister la première fois la base. La borne mobile opère alors un premier canal du trafic qui est unsynchronized au premier canal de commande et note la différence dans des bases de temps entre le canal de commande et le canal du trafic. L'un ou l'autre tandis que campé sur le canal de commande ou tout en fonctionnant sur le canal du trafic, la borne mobile reçoit les données du rapport TDMA-à-Généralistes, qui sont une mesure de l'excentrage entre le moment de système pour le système de communications sans fil comme exprimé sur le canal particulier de commande ("temps de TDMA") et le moment de système pour le système de GPS ("temps de GPS"). Ensuite, une évaluation précise du temps de GPS est calculée dans la borne mobile basée sur la référence d'horloge locale et les données du rapport TDMA-à-Généralistes. Dans quelques aspects, la référence d'horloge locale est mise à jour basée sur le premier canal du trafic afin de réduire au minimum des erreurs résultant de la dérive de synchronisation.